South Coast Botanic Garden’s mission is to connect ALL to the wonders of nature and create experiences that inspire stewardship and sustainability. This 87-acre destination features a unique blend of curated gardens, natural landscapes, and immersive exhibits—all built atop a reclaimed landfill, showcasing the transformative power of nature. From the Dorothy and John Bohannon Rose Garden to the Living Wall art installation and seasonal Butterfly Pavilion, the Garden offers dynamic experiences for guests of all ages. With continued growth, including the upcoming 3.5-acre Children and Family Garden, this is an exciting time to join a collaborative and mission-driven team. The Development Coordinator plays a critical support role in advancing the Garden’s fundraising initiatives, including institutional giving, sponsorships, major gifts, and membership programs. This is a highly collaborative, non-exempt role responsible for coordinating donor engagement efforts, supporting events, maintaining data integrity, and providing administrative and project support to the Development team. The position requires a detail-oriented, proactive professional who thrives in a fast-paced environment and can manage multiple priorities with accuracy and professionalism. The ideal candidate is highly organized, adaptable, and eager to grow within nonprofit development while contributing to continuous process improvement and exceptional donor stewardship.
